Job Description
We are looking for dynamic and enthusiastic individuals to work within PwC’s Targeted Delivery Team (current 7 people and part of PwC’s Online Presence Team) to support and implement online client collaboration tools within our business.

It is expected that support and deployment related tasks will take up 80% of the position with the remainder of your time will be spent as a relationship manager on the projects you are implementing, training internal and external clients to use the environments effectively or as a Junior Project Manager on other related projects.

Although this role is within a technology arena, a pure technology background is not necessarily a pre-requisite as PwC as training will be provided, therefore this role would potentially suit new graduates or candidates wishing to move into the technology or business development sectors.

Online collaboration has growing importance within PwC, providing clients and staff with secure sharing environments. Mindlink is a secure web based area used to provide increased interactivity and effective collaboration between PwC teams and their clients and targets. This is an internal customer focused role supporting and undertaking the technical administration and setup of collaborative solutions (MindLink) where you will be the first point of contact for queries in relation to collaboration.

Candidates must have exceptional communication skills and the ability to manage multiple tasks efficiently.

Responsibilities:

- Create and administer existing/new Client Portals, Workrooms and other Collaboration tools. 

- Answering the Collaboration helpline and resolving/monitoring support calls, escalating where necessary. 

- Provide ongoing administrative support to existing PwC client teams e.g. resolving technical queries, adding additional users, managing maintenance/upgrades, generally providing a figure head for the team when dealing with enquires from site administrators and new requests. 

- Conduct presentations and training sessions for Mindlink with PwC teams and their clients and advise on structures and most appropriate implementation methods and tools to site administrators and team members and undertake demonstrations of related technology to internal PwC Client teams as required. 

- Assist with user training and help develop suitable training materials/methods and the development and maintance of the our internal collaboration website. 

- Preparing ongoing communications to our internal clients as required. 

- Analysis and interpretation of client usage and feedback. 

- Further ad-hoc tasks as generated by your self-initiative or within the role.
